Assessing the performance of ChatGPT in answering questions regarding cirrhosis and hepatocellular carcinoma

2023-02-08

Abstract excerpt

<h4>Background</h4> Patients with cirrhosis and hepatocellular carcinoma (HCC) require extensive and personalized care to improve outcomes. ChatGPT (Generative Pre-trained Transformer), a natural language processing model, holds potential to provide professional yet patient-friendly support. <h4>Aim</h4> Examining the accuracy and reproducibility of ChatGPT in answering questions regarding knowledge, management, a...
